4.6.7 IP Filtering Settings
Operation Mode -> Setup -> IP Filtering Settings
IP filtering is simply a mechanism that decides which types of IP datagram will be
processed normally and which will be discarded.
This allows you to define rules for allowing / denying access from / to the Internet. Please
do set both inbound/outbound in order to get complete connection. Only inbound or
outbound will not allow to get response from the destination IP.
Disable IP filtering: No IP filtering is performed.
Grant IP access: Data traffic satisfying rules below are allowed / forwarded.
Deny IP access: Data traffic satisfying rules below are denied / filtered.
